There is a specific way the first spend analysis review fails. The deck goes up, the categories look reasonable, and then someone senior says: that facilities number cannot be right, we spent more than that on cleaning alone. They are usually correct about their own area, and from that moment the meeting is about data quality rather than about spend.

The technical work was probably fine. What failed was that nobody could say how accurate the classification was, so one visible error was indistinguishable from systemic unreliability. That is a design problem, and it is fixable before the first slide is written.

Design for the decision, not for the standard

The first instinct is to adopt an established scheme — UNSPSC or similar — because it is comprehensive and neutral. For most mid-market organisations that is a mistake, and the reason is worth being precise about.

A standard taxonomy is designed to classify everything anyone might buy. Yours needs to classify what you actually buy, at the level at which somebody could do something about it. Those produce very different structures. A universal scheme will give you four hundred categories, of which three hundred and forty are empty, twelve hold 80% of the value, and none maps to how your organisation is actually managed.

Three levels is almost always enough. Level 1 for the board view, Level 2 for the category owner, Level 3 for the sourcing exercise. A fourth level is occasionally justified in one large category and is usually a sign that someone is classifying for its own sake.

The cleansing that has to happen first

Classification accuracy is capped by supplier data quality, and the cap binds much lower than people expect. Four problems account for most of it.

Duplicate suppliers
The same company under three records — an abbreviation, a legal name, a typo. Their spend is split three ways and each fragment lands below whatever threshold gets attention.
Parent-child relationships
Six subsidiaries of one group, each looking like a mid-sized supplier. Aggregate them and you have a top-ten relationship you did not know you had, and considerably more negotiating leverage than you thought.
Conglomerate suppliers
A supplier who sells you three unrelated things. Classifying by supplier puts all of it in one category and makes both categories wrong.
Uninformative descriptions
Line text reading "services", "miscellaneous" or a project code. Frequently 20–30% of lines, and no algorithm recovers meaning that was never recorded.

The first two are mechanical and worth doing properly, because they change conclusions rather than tidy data. The third means accepting that some suppliers must be classified at line level. The fourth is the one that sets your realistic accuracy ceiling, and it needs to be stated up front rather than discovered in the review.

Classify by value, not by line count

Automated classification handles the bulk cheaply and is confidently wrong on the residue. The mistake is to measure its success by the share of lines classified, because spend distributions are heavily skewed: a rule set can classify 85% of lines and still leave a large share of value unresolved, since the highest-value lines are frequently the most bespoke and the least well described.

A sequence that produces a defensible result:

  1. Auto-classify by supplier where the supplier sells one thing. This is fast and reliable.
  2. Auto-classify by line description where descriptions are structured — catalogue items and contracted goods usually are.
  3. Manually classify every remaining line above a value threshold. Set the threshold so that manual review covers at least 90% of the unresolved value, not a fixed number of lines.
  4. Bucket the rest as unclassified and report the number. Do not hide it in "Other".

That last point is the one that determines whether the analysis survives its first meeting. A visible, honest unclassified figure of 4% is a credibility asset. The same 4% quietly folded into "Other" is the thing that gets discovered, and when it does it takes the rest of the numbers with it.

Prove the accuracy before you present

Very few spend analyses state their own error rate, which is why they are so easily challenged. Measuring it is a day of work.

Take a random sample — a few hundred lines, weighted by value rather than uniformly, since a misclassified large line matters more. Have someone who did not build the rules classify them independently. Compare. Report the agreement rate at each taxonomy level.

Two things follow. You can now open the review with a stated accuracy rather than an implied one, which changes the meeting from an interrogation into a discussion. And the disagreements themselves are the improvement backlog: they cluster, and the clusters point at the specific rules or suppliers that need attention.

It decays, and the decay rate is predictable

A classified spend set is accurate on the day it is built and degrades from then on, because new suppliers arrive unclassified and existing ones change what they sell. A one-off exercise is therefore a snapshot with a short shelf life, and the second-year version usually costs as much as the first because it is redone from scratch.

What prevents that is small and continuous: classify new suppliers at the point of creation, refresh monthly rather than annually, and keep the rule set as a living asset rather than a project artefact. Handled that way the refresh is hours; handled as a project it is a re-run.
